Alibaba’s 133% Cloud EBITA Surge Validates In-House Chips—Even as the Stock Sells Off

Alibaba reported June-quarter 2026 earnings on August 20, and the most consequential number sat buried inside a freshly created reporting segment. AI Cloud and Compute Services—a new unit combining the old Cloud Intelligence Group with T-Head, Alibaba's semiconductor arm—posted adjusted EBITA of RMB5.63 billion on RMB48.44 billion of revenue. That is a margin of roughly 11.6%, up approximately 440 basis points from a year earlier, when the same operations earned 7.2%. Revenue rose 45%. EBITA rose 133%.

Alibaba ADRs fell about 5% by midday.

The Consolidated Pain Behind the Segment Gain

The divergence between segment strength and share-price weakness has a straightforward explanation. Group revenue grew only 9%. Adjusted EBITA dropped 30%. Net income collapsed roughly 75%. Free cash flow was negative RMB44.7 billion. Quarterly capex surged 75% to RMB67.7 billion—Alibaba said the cost of deploying some new servers had roughly doubled year-on-year because of component scarcity.

The other new segment tells the rest of the story. AI Labs and Applications, housing Qwen model development and consumer AI products, generated RMB3.34 billion of revenue against an adjusted EBITA loss of RMB13.86 billion. That single-segment loss is 2.46 times the entire positive EBITA produced by AI Cloud and Compute. Building the whole AI stack remains extraordinarily expensive even when one layer of it is working.

Zhenwu Reaches Commercial Scale

At the Zhenwu M890 chip launch in May, Alibaba said more than 560,000 Zhenwu-family accelerators had shipped to over 400 external customers. By the June-quarter release, that count exceeded 650 across more than 20 industries. On August 12, a 64-accelerator M890 supernode went into commercial service in Inner Mongolia, serving mixture-of-experts models with up to 10 trillion parameters. Kimi K3 and Qwen3.8-Max already run on it.

The corporate reorganization formalized this direction: merging T-Head into the cloud segment treats chip, server, network, cloud and model as one economic stack. Capital allocation matched the rhetoric. Share repurchases totaled just US$162 million—capex outspent buybacks by a factor exceeding 60—and a WSJ-reported memo disclosed that Alibaba agreed to sell Lingxi Games to Trustar Capital for over US$1.5 billion. Peripheral assets are being liquidated to fund compute.

Sanctions Created a Hybrid, and the Hybrid Favors Alibaba

A Financial Times report on August 19 revealed that Beijing has begun allowing limited Nvidia H200 imports, with ByteDance and Tencent each receiving approximately 10,000 chips. Washington had been willing to approve larger volumes; China itself is restricting deployment to cultivate domestic accelerator adoption.

The architecture emerging across Chinese hyperscalers is therefore heterogeneous: scarce Nvidia GPUs reserved for frontier training where CUDA and raw throughput justify the premium, domestic silicon like Zhenwu absorbing high-volume inference and production workloads where availability and cost-per-token matter more. Alibaba can monetize customers on whichever side they land. Those wanting Nvidia rent it through Alibaba Cloud. Those whose workloads run economically on Zhenwu consume Alibaba's own silicon—and Alibaba captures more of the stack. A standalone GPU-rental cloud generally lacks that second option.

Distribution Is the Actual Moat

This is where the earnings data converge into the specific insight that most coverage has missed. The defensibility of Alibaba's custom silicon program comes less from transistor benchmarks than from the fact that Alibaba can make its chip the default backend behind an existing cloud API. A Chinese accelerator startup must persuade a customer to buy unfamiliar hardware, retool a datacenter, rewrite CUDA kernels and accept adoption risk. Alibaba slots M890 underneath Model Studio, Qwen deployments or an existing cloud tenancy, and the customer never makes a "buy domestic silicon" procurement decision at all.

Alibaba then amortizes chip R&D and depreciation across internal commerce workloads (Taobao, Amap), Qwen inference, and hundreds of external cloud tenants. An independent compute lessor gets one monetization path. Alibaba gets several.

If AI Cloud and Compute margins keep expanding toward the mid-teens while capex remains elevated, U.S. export controls will have accomplished something Washington probably did not intend: accelerating the construction of a vertically integrated Chinese semiconductor-cloud platform whose competitive advantage compounds through distribution, workload density and a captive customer base that adopted the silicon without ever choosing to.
